40 Brae Street, Bronte NSW 2024

Description
Remove one (1) Robinia pseudoacacia (Golden robinia) northernmost leader from the backyard, adjacent to the eastern boundary and replace with one (1) local native tree from Council’s Preferred Tree list, of minimum 45L pot size, growing to similar dimensions at maturity, anywhere on the property, within one (1) month of removal. Golden Robinia: The northernmost leader has succumbed to poor health and has a bare canopy and brittle branches, the cause could not be identified during the visual tree inspection. Its removal is recommended to provide the southernmost Robinia more energy to thrive. Prune one (1) Morus nigra (Mulberry tree) and one (1) Robinia pseudoacacia (Golden robinia) southernmost leader from the backyard, adjacent to the eastern boundary.
